Méndez Puts Photomults and Vehicle Inspections as a Priority

Summary by N Digital
By Rosa Batista, Santo Domingo.- The director of the National Institute of Transit and Land Transport (Intrant), Juan Manuel Méndez, reported that his management will focus, in the short term, on several areas that he considers fundamental to...
